Wind

Overview:

Launched on November 1st, 1994; WINDs Position was in a sunward, multiple double-lunar swing orbit with a maximum apogee of 250Re during the first two years of operation. It was followed by a halo orbit at the Earth-Sun L1 point.

Objectives:

  • Provide complete plasma, energetic particle, and magnetic field input for magnetospheric and ionospheric studies
  • Determine the magnetospheric output to interplanetary space in the up-stream region
  • Investigate basic plasma processes occurring in the near-Earth solar wind
  • Provide baseline ecliptic plane observations to be used in heliospheric latitudes from ULYSSES

Experiments:

  • WAVES Radio and Plasma Wave experiment
  • EPACT Energetic Particle Acceleration, Composition and Transport
  • SWE Solar Wind Experiment
  • SMS Solar Wind and Suprathermal Ion Composition Studies
  • MFI Magnetic Fields Investigation
  • 3D Plasma and Energetic Particle Analyzer
